Monitoring underground coal mining - induced subsidence
Monitoring of mine subsidence by means of classical methods such as optical levelling or Global Positioning System (GPS) surveys can reveal deformations with sub-millimetre to subcentimetre precision for localised areas. However, to provide data on a reasonably dense two-dimensional (2D) benchmark grid are costly and time-consuming for all but the smallest areas. Moreover, a regular re-survey o...

متن کاملEcological impacts of large-scale disposal of mining waste in the deep sea
Deep-Sea Tailings Placement (DSTP) from terrestrial mines is one of several large-scale industrial activities now taking place in the deep sea. The scale and persistence of its impacts on seabed biota are unknown. We sampled around the Lihir and Misima island mines in Papua New Guinea to measure the impacts of ongoing DSTP and assess the state of benthic infaunal communities after its conclusio...
